We test the effectiveness of self-help peer groups as a commitment device for precautionary savings, through two … randomized field experiments among 2,687 microentrepreneurs in Chile. The first experiment finds that self-help peer groups are a … powerful tool to increase savings (the number of deposits grows 3.5-fold and the average savings balance almost doubles …

To analyze the prospects for expanding financial access to the poor, bank professionals assessed 1,438 households in six provinces in Indonesia to judge their creditworthiness. About 40 percent of poor households were judged creditworthy according to the criteria of Indonesia's largest...

This paper constructs time series data on savings per type of agent for Chile during the period 1960-2012. It is found … that the economy's average savings rate increased by 11 percentage points in the period 1985-2012 compared to 1960- 1984 …, with particularly pronounced growth in corporate savings.
